+%description
+GNU dbm is a library of database functions that use extensible
+hashing and work similar to the standard UNIX dbm. These routines are
+provided to a programmer needing to create and manipulate a hashed
+database.
+
+The basic use of GDBM is to store key/data pairs in a data file. Each
+key must be unique and each key is paired with only one data item.
+
+The library provides primitives for storing key/data pairs, searching
+and retrieving the data by its key and deleting a key along with its
+data. It also supports sequential iteration over all key/data pairs in
+a database.
+
+For compatibility with programs using old UNIX dbm functions, the
+package also provides traditional dbm and ndbm interfaces.
